Description

5-(2-Phosphonoethyl)Pyridoxal is a chemically modified, phosphorylated derivative of vitamin B6 (pyridoxal). This compound matters as a key biochemical intermediate and research tool, particularly in the study of enzyme cofactors, metabolic pathways, and vitamin B6-dependent processes. It is needed by researchers and manufacturers in the pharmaceutical, biotechnology, and life science sectors for applications in drug discovery, biochemical research, and the development of diagnostic reagents.

Application

  • Biochemical Research: Used as a substrate or inhibitor in studies of pyridoxal phosphate-dependent enzymes, such as transaminases and decarboxylases.
  • Pharmaceutical Intermediates: Serves as a key building block in the synthesis of novel therapeutic agents targeting metabolic disorders.
  • Enzyme Mechanism Studies: Employed to investigate the role of the phosphoryl group in enzyme binding and catalysis.
  • Diagnostic Reagent Development: A potential component in the formulation of assay kits for clinical diagnostics and metabolic profiling.
  • Nutritional Science Research: Used to study the metabolism, transport, and biological activity of vitamin B6 analogs.
  • Cofactor Analog Synthesis: Acts as a precursor for the synthesis of more complex, tailored enzyme cofactor analogs for specialized research.

Basic Information

Product Name 5-(2-Phosphonoethyl)Pyridoxal
CAS No. 32555-98-9
Molecular Formula C10H14NO7P
Molecular Weight 291.20 g/mol
Synonyms 5-(2-Phosphonoethyl)-3-hydroxy-2-methyl-4-pyridinecarboxaldehyde; Pyridoxal 2-Phosphonoethyl Ether; 5-(2-Phosphonoethyl)pyridoxal; Vitamin B6 Phosphonate Derivative; PLP Ethylphosphonate Analog; 3-Hydroxy-5-(phosphonoethyl)-2-methyl-4-pyridinecarboxaldehyde; 5-Phosphonoethylpyridoxal

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ed in a desiccated environment to prevent degradation.
